Ticket: align versioning policy for the Quillform shared component library. Currently teams pin mixed major versions, which causes support tickets when styles diverge between Larchgate apps. Proposal: enforce semver with a deprecation window of two minors, plus automated upgrade notes in each release. Support should route version-mismatch reports to this ticket until approved. Requires sign-off from the maintainer named below.

account owner for bawip-tahag: Raleth Quenok

Ticket: AGR-4412 — Harvestline telemetry gateway drops packets after firmware handshake. Steps to reproduce: 1) Power-cycle a Plowmark 300 unit in the field simulator. 2) Wait for the gateway at /ingest/v1 to acknowledge the handshake. 3) Send three telemetry frames within two seconds. Expected: all frames stored. Actual: frames two and three return 502. Logs show the auth cache invalidating mid-session. To replay the requests against staging, authenticate with the bearer token below.

session JWT of yawep-yawep = eyJhbGciOiJIUzI1NiIsInR5cCI6IkpXVCJ9.eyJzdWIiOiI3pWF3_In0.aXYsHiog

## Who to ping: encoding detection

Quick reference for the eng sync. The charset sniffer in Inkspool (the upload service) is owned by the Textflow pod. Known quirks: it misreads short Latin-2 files as Windows-1252, and BOM-less UTF-16 uploads sometimes land as mojibake. Workaround is to re-upload with an explicit encoding header. Don't file these against the storage team — they'll just bounce it back. Questions, edge cases, or false-detection reports go to the Textflow pod at the address below.

escalation mailbox, bafog-fafog: ulador@paliqlabs.internal

**Ticket PARITY-412: Kestrel SDK catch-up**

Quick one for the weekly sync: the Kestrel-Go SDK is still missing batched uploads and retry hints that Kestrel-JS shipped two releases ago. Partner teams keep asking. Plan is to land both behind a flag this sprint and cut a minor release. Needs a sign-off from the owner named below.

account owner for bajef-badup: Drueth Kelath Pelael Holwyn